Appendix D
This appendix lists Microsoft Project keyboard shortcuts for commonly used commands and operations you might otherwise carry out using the mouse.
Table D-1. Working with Files
Action | Keyboard shortcut |
---|---|
New | Ctrl+N or F11 |
Open | Ctrl+O |
Ctrl+P | |
Save | Ctrl+S |
Save As | F12 or Alt+F2 |
Close | Ctrl+F4 |
Exit | Alt+F4 |
Table D-2. Working with Views and Windows
Action | Keyboard shortcut |
---|---|
Activate the other pane in a combination view | F6 |
Activate the next project window | Ctrl+F6 |
Activate the previous project window | Ctrl+Shift+F6 |
Activate the split bar | Shift+F6 |
Close the project window | Ctrl+F4 |
Zoom in | Ctrl+/ |
Zoom out | Ctrl+Shift+* |
Close the program window | Alt+F4 |
Open a new window | Shift+F11 or Alt+Shift+F1 |
Table D-3. Navigating in a Project View
Action | Keyboard shortcut |
---|---|
Move to the next task or resource | Enter or down arrow |
Move to the previous task or resource | Shift+Enter or up arrow |
Move the timescale to the beginning of the project | Alt+Home |
Move the timescale to the end of the project | Alt+End |
Move left one page | Ctrl+Page Up |
Move right one page | Ctrl+Page Down |
Move the timescale left | Alt+Left Arrow |
Move the timescale right | Alt+Right Arrow |
Move the timescale one screen left | Alt+Page Up |
Move the timescale one screen right | Alt+Page Down |
Move to the first field of the first row | Ctrl+Home |
Move to the last field in a row | End or Ctrl+Right Arrow |
Move to the last field of the last row | Ctrl+End |
Move to the last field in a window | End |
Move to the last row | Ctrl+Down Arrow |
Move left, right, up, or down to view different pages in the Print Preview window | Alt+Arrow Keys |
Table D-4. Opening and Working in Dialog Boxes
Action | Keyboard shortcut |
---|---|
Open the Task Information, Resource Information, or Assignment Information dialog box | Shift+F2 |
Open the Assign Resources dialog box | Alt+F10 |
Open the Column Definition dialog box | Alt+F3 |
Open the Macros dialog box | Alt+F8 |
Open the Visual Basic Editor | Alt+F11 |
Move to the next tab in a tabbed dialog box (the tabs must already have focus) | Arrow keys |
Move to the next box, group, option, button, or tab | Tab |
Move to the previous box, group, option, button, or tab | Shift+Tab |
Move to the next option in group | Right Arrow or Down Arrow |
Move to the previous option in a group | Left Arrow or Up Arrow |
Show a list in a drop-down list | Alt+Down Arrow |
Show the next item in a drop-down list | Down Arrow |
Show the previous item in a drop-down list | Up Arrow |
Select an option, check box, or button | Spacebar |
Table D-5. Editing
Action | Keyboard shortcut |
---|---|
Cut selection | Ctrl+X |
Copy selection | Ctrl+C |
Paste contents of Clipboard | Ctrl+V |
Fill down | Ctrl+D |
Insert task, resource, field | Insert |
Delete task, resource, field | Delete |
Find | Ctrl+F or Shift+F5 |
Find again | Shift+F4 |
Go to | F5 or Ctrl+G |
Check spelling | F7 |
Undo last action | Ctrl+Z |
Table D-6. Outlining
Action | Keyboard shortcut |
---|---|
Indent | Alt+Shift+Right Arrow |
Outdent | Alt+Shift+Left Arrow |
Hide subtasks | Alt+Shift+Minus Sign (Hyphen) |
Show subtasks | Alt+Shift+ = |
Show all tasks | Alt+Shift+* |
Table D-7. Giving Special Commands
Action | Keyboard shortcut |
---|---|
Link tasks | Ctrl+F2 |
Unlink tasks | Ctrl+Shift+F2 |
Reset sort to ID order | Shift+F3 |
Remove a filter and show all tasks or all resources | F3 |
Insert hyperlink | Ctrl+K |
Calculate scheduling changes in all open projects | F9 |
Calculate scheduling changes in the active project | Shift+F9 |
Switch between automatic and manual calculation | Ctrl+F9 |
Open the Office Assistant or the online Help window | F1 |
Activate the context-sensitive Help pointer in a dialog box | Shift+F1 |
Find more keyboard shortcuts
To find additional keyboard shortcuts, you can use Microsoft Project online Help. In the Ask A Question box in the menu bar, type keyboard shortcut and then press Enter. Click the Keyboard Commands link.
